甲醇制丙烯工艺冷凝液处理的改进

摘    要:甲醇制丙烯工艺冷凝液中的含铁量和含油量,会因工艺换热器的渗漏而超标,致使传统的除油除铁设施频繁出现故障,为此,经过对工艺冷凝液除油除铁系统的工艺改进,有效地解决了传统除油除铁设施存在的不足,满足了后续冷凝液精制单元稳定、长周期运行的需求。

Improvement of Methanol to Propylene Process Condensate Treatment

Abstract:Iron content and oil content in the Methanol to propylene condensate exceeded standard due to leakage of heat exchanger which made the traditional oil and iron removing facilities frequent malfunction. In order to effectively solve the shortage of the traditional oil and iron removing facilities, the process of oil and iron removing system of condensate was improved to meet the demand of stability and long period running of subsequent condensate refining unit.
